India to impose AD duty on aluminum foil from China

India's Ministry of Finance, Department of Revenue, announced that it decided to impose an anti-dumping (AD) duty on aluminum foil from China for thickness up to 80 microns for five years. It was the recommendation from the Ministry of Commerce and Industry for the final decision on AD published on March 20, 2025.

The AD margins for different Chinese producers and exporters are US$479-721 per ton. The HS codes for subject products are 7607 11 10, 7607 11 90, 7607 19 10, 7607 19 91, 7607 19 92, 7607 19 93, 7607 19 94, 7607 19 95, 7607 19 99, 7607 20 10, and 7607 20 90. Some products with specific sizes and usage are excluded.

The Ministry of Finance imposed a provisional AD duty for six months with a duty margin of US$619-873 per ton on March 17, 2025.
